Commutative Rings whose Finitely Generated Modules Decompose
Brandal, Willy.
Commutative Rings whose Finitely Generated Modules Decompose [electronic resource] / by Willy Brandal. - IV, 116 p. online resource. - Lecture Notes in Mathematics, 723 0075-8434 ; . - Lecture Notes in Mathematics, 723 .
Linearly compact modules and almost maximal rings -- h-Local domains -- Valuation rings and Bezout rings -- Basic facts about FGC rings and the local case -- Further facts about FGC rings and Torch rings -- The Zariski and Patch topologies of the spectrum of a ring -- The Stone-Cech compactification of N -- Relating topology to the decomposition of modules -- The main theorem -- Valuations -- Long power series rings -- Maximally complete valuation domains -- Examples of maximal valuation rings -- Examples of almost maximal Bezout domains -- Examples of Torch rings.
